#030f1f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#030f1f is composed of 1.2% red, 5.9%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.3% cyan, 51.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 87.8% black. It has a hue angle of 214.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.4% and a lightness of 6.7%. #030f1f color hex could be obtained by blending #061e3e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

● #030f1f color description : Very dark (mostly black) blue.
#030f1f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#030f1f has RGB values of R:3, G:15, B:31 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.88. Its decimal value is 200479.
